How Does a Whole-House Generator Work?
A whole-house generator acts as an emergency power backup unit and automatically starts when the main power source is off. According to the information from some prominent websites, this is what I gather about the said process:
- Power Detection and Activation: Back-up generators have a transfer switch that senses if there are any power outages. Once it detects a power failure it will immediately engage the generator and its engine so that electricity can flow to designated circuits in your home.
- Fuel Source: Natural gas or propane fuels the generator engine which is able to produce electricity and maintains reliability. It should be mentioned that these fuels are already piped to the house, so there is no need to manually switch the generator on.
- Electrical Output: The generated electrical energy or metered to range between 7500-20000 watts mainly reserved for household use is fed to the electrical system of the house. The specification determines how many active appliances and systems can be run concurrently, it is important to purchase one with enough wattage for the needs of your household since there are several types of generators in the market today.

How Does the Installation Process Work for a Whole-House Generator?
What Steps Are Involved in Generator Installation?
The installation of a whole-house generator typically involves several critical steps, each necessary to ensure safe and efficient operation. Based on the top three resources available online, here’s an outline of the essential steps:
- Address and Considerations: This is always preceded by an analysis of the home’s power needs and determination of the best generator size for the home. This stage first loads normally operating generators and installs them so that they do not exceed the load requirements of the household.
- Site Selection: These may include scope for generator units to have utility connections, sky heights, allowable noise levels as well as space required for cooling. This step will also include compliance with codes and standards in the area regarding the building and fire safety of the building site.
- Permit: Regulations are normally required to be adhered to in respect of building codes as well as electrical codes and this provides a basis for most activities toward installation.
- Preparing the Base: In preparation for the installation of the generator unit, an appropriate base such as a concrete pad is first provided.
- Wiring: When the generator is installed, it is automatically connected to the electrical systems of the house via an automatic transfer switch. This requires proper and precise wiring in order to accomplish the smooth transition of power and safety measures.
- Fuel System Integration: The last stage is connecting the fuel source including natural gas, diesel or propane. In this stage, it is necessary to ensure that the fuel type is appropriate and the lines are appropriately sized to preclude pressures from becoming excessive.
- Testing and Final Checks: After installation, thorough checking is performed to ascertain that the system is working, and load capacity, transfer switch, and fuel line are inspected.

How Long Does Whole-House Generator Installation Take?
The duration for completing the entire process of installation of whole house generators depends on several factors including site preparation, permission procedures, and the design of the installations themselves. The whole procedure often takes a period of between one to two weeks at most.
- Permits and site assessment: Carrying out a site assessment and applying for the permits may take a few days up to a week depending on the local authorities and their official’s workload.
- Generator foundation and placement: more often than not, preparing the generator and placement usually takes 1 to 3 days. The time taken usually varies and is majorly dependent on the type of base that is being used and the prevailing weather conditions.
- Power and fuel connection: These processes may take another 1 to 2 days. This stage is important in maintaining safety and it involves intricacies of detail.
- Final inspection and system testing: Lastly, testing the system and carrying out the necessary inspection where required may take another one to two days, this is the final step of ensuring that the generator is working properly and meets all the safety and technical requirements.
With regard to all the time frames given above, we can say that one to two weeks should be enough but of course, such projects may take longer due to other unexpected challenges or another extension in their design. What Are the Costs Associated with Whole-House Generator Installation?
How Much Does a Whole-House Generator Cost?
The price of a whole-house generator depends on factors such as brand, size, and structural features that support installation. Whole-house generators typically cost anywhere from three to five thousand dollars. The price of installation ranges from two thousand dollars to five thousand dollars depending on the amount of work required and the rates paid for labor in the locality.
Technical Parameters:
- Generator Size: This has to be sized according to the energy requirements of that family, which for an average household, tends to lie between 10 – 20 kilowatt range.
- Fuel Type: Generators can operate either on natural gas, propane, or diesel fuels. However, for home installations, propane and natural gas are the most popular.
- Transfer Switch: In order to enable an automatic transfer from the generator’s power to the main power grid, an automatic transfer switch that is operationally compatible is required.
- Voltage Compatibility: The generator in question has to work with the electricity system of the house, which in most US homes is usually around 120/240 Volts.
- Clearance and Placement: The guidelines for Installation detail clear zones such as doors and windows which are required by the law.

What Factors Influence Installation Costs?
When addressing what influences installation costs for a whole-house generator, several key factors emerge. These factors include:
- Site Preparation: The condition and readiness of the site can significantly impact cost as well. The necessity of considerable groundwork to fit the generator base would definitely shoot costs.
- Electrical Upgrades: Depending on the age and condition of the home’s electrical systems, it may be necessary to alter them to accommodate the generator. Such as changing the panel board or replacing wire if conditions are really dire.
- Permits and Inspections: There are some local laws and regulations which might require certain permits and inspections, thus increasing costs and complications. This component however may include encroachment of specific region codes.
- Distance to Fuel Source: The length of pipe installed to reach the house’s fuel source, impacts the cost of generating power. Longer distances will necessitate extra piping and more work.
- Additional Features: Certain systems may also raise the overall cost of installation.

Q: Is it necessary to have a transfer switch for my home backup generator?
A: Yes, a transfer switch is necessary for safely connecting your home backup generator to your electrical system. It prevents backfeeding into the grid, which can be dangerous for utility workers and your home’s electrical system.
